West Palm Beach, Fl vs Repetek Climate & Distance Between

Turkmenistan flag
  • The distance between West Palm Beach, Fl, Usa and Repetek, Turkmenistan is approximately 11,816 km or 7,343 mi.
  • To reach West Palm Beach, Fl in this distance one would set out from Repetek bearing 326.2°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ach West Palm Beach, Fl bearing 209.1° or SSW .
  • West Palm Beach, Fl has a tropical rainforest climate (Af) whereas Repetek has a mid-latitude cool desert climate (BWk).
  • West Palm Beach, Fl is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Repetek is in or near the warm temperate desert biome.
  • The mean temperature is 7.2 °C (13°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 20.6 °C (37.1°F) less in West Palm Beach, Fl.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ly continental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1420.2 mm (55.9 in) more which is equivalent to 1420.2 l/m² (34.86 US gal/ft²) or 14,202,000 l/ha (1,518,288 US gal/ac) more. About 12 4/7 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 11.9° higher in West Palm Beach, Fl than in Repetek.
